The sedan Honda Civic 1995 - 2000 year modification 1.5 MT (130 hp)

Engine

Engine type petrol
Engine location front, transverse
Engine capacity, cm³ 1493
Boost type No
Maximum power, hp/kW at rpm 130 / 96 at 7000
Maximum torque, N*m at rpm 139 at 5300
Cylinder arrangement in-line
Number of cylinders 4
Number of valves per cylinder 4
Engine power supply system distributed injection
Compression ratio 9.6
Cylinder diameter and piston stroke, mm 75 × 84.5

General information

Brand country Japan
Model assembly Japan
Car class C
Number of doors 4

Performance indicators

Fuel consumption, l city / highway / combined — / — / 5.3
Fuel type Normal (92)

Sizes in mm

Length 4460
Width 1695
Height 1390
Wheelbase 2620
Ground clearance 150
Front track width 1478
Rear track width 1488

Suspension and brakes

Type of front suspension independent, spring
Type of rear suspension independent, spring
Front brakes disk ventilated
Rear brakes drum

Transmission

Transmission mechanical
Number of gears 5
Drive type front

Volume and weight

Fuel tank capacity, l 45
Curb weight, kg 1030
Trunk volume min/max, l 335

Honda Civic 1.5 MT (130 hp): A Reliable and Efficient Sedan

The Honda Civic, a well-known name in the automotive world, has been a symbol of reliability, efficiency, and practicality since its inception. The 1.5 MT (130 hp) variant, produced between 1995 and 2000, is a prime example of Honda's commitment to engineering excellence. This sedan, with its timeless design and robust performance, continues to be a favorite among car enthusiasts and everyday drivers alike.

Performance and Efficiency

Under the hood, the Honda Civic 1.5 MT boasts a 1.5-liter, 4-cylinder petrol engine that delivers 130 horsepower at 7000 rpm and 139 Nm of torque at 5300 rpm. The engine's in-line cylinder arrangement and distributed injection system ensure smooth and efficient power delivery. With a combined fuel consumption of just 5.3 liters per 100 kilometers, this car is an excellent choice for those seeking a balance between performance and fuel economy. The 5-speed manual transmission and front-wheel drive provide a responsive and engaging driving experience, making it a joy to navigate both city streets and highways.

Design and Dimensions

The Honda Civic's sedan body type offers a sleek and aerodynamic profile, with dimensions of 4460 mm in length, 1695 mm in width, and 1390 mm in height. The 2620 mm wheelbase ensures a comfortable ride, while the 150 mm ground clearance allows for confident handling on various road conditions. The car's 4-door configuration and 335-liter trunk capacity make it a practical choice for families and individuals who value space and convenience.
